Dealey Plaza , named after George Dealey, is a city park in the West End Historic District of downtown Dallas, Texas. It is sometimes called the "birthplace of Dallas", and was the location of the assassination of John F. Kennedy in 1963. The Dealey Plaza Historic District was named a National Historic Landmark on the 30th anniversary of the assassination, to preserve Dealey Plaza, street rights-of-way, buildings, and structures by the plaza visible from the assassination site, which have been identified as witness locations or as possible locations for the assassin.

When was Dealey Plaza Historic District listed on the National Register?
Dealey Plaza Historic District was listed on the National Register of Historic Places on April 18, 1993.
What type of historic resource is Dealey Plaza Historic District?
Dealey Plaza Historic District is classified as a district in the National Register of Historic Places.
Is Dealey Plaza Historic District a National Historic Landmark?
Yes. Dealey Plaza Historic District has been designated a National Historic Landmark (NHL), the highest level of federal recognition for historic properties in the United States.
What is the period of significance for Dealey Plaza Historic District?
The period of significance for Dealey Plaza Historic District is recorded as the modern era, specifically around 1963.
